Introduction
In the captivating memoir, "Me" by Ricky Martin, the renowned Puerto Rican singer takes readers on an intimate journey through his life, from his early days as a child performer to his rise to international stardom. With heartfelt candor, Martin shares his personal experiences, struggles, and triumphs, providing a rare glimpse into the life of a global icon.
Brief Synopsis
The book "Me" is divided into four parts, each exploring different phases of Ricky Martin's life. It begins with his childhood in Puerto Rico, where he discovered his passion for music and performing at a young age. The memoir then delves into his teenage years, as he grapples with his identity and sexuality while navigating the music industry.
As the story progresses, Ricky Martin recounts his time with the Latin boy band Menudo and his subsequent solo career, which propelled him to superstardom. He shares the challenges he faced as a gay artist in the mainstream music industry and his journey towards self-acceptance.
The memoir also addresses Martin's experiences as a father, his humanitarian work, and his exploration of spirituality. Through his honest and introspective storytelling, Martin invites readers into the moments that shaped him and offers a glimpse into the man behind the music.

Summary of Story Points
Part 1: Becoming Ricky
In this section, Ricky Martin reflects on his childhood and early experiences in the entertainment industry. He discusses his humble beginnings in Puerto Rico, his love for music, and his discovery of his talent at a young age. Martin also opens up about the challenges he faced as a child performer and the impact it had on his personal growth.
Part 2: Menudo Days
This part of the memoir focuses on Martin's time in the Latin boy band Menudo. He shares the excitement and pressures of being a member of the group, as well as the sacrifices he had to make for his career. Martin also discusses the challenges of growing up in the spotlight and the impact it had on his identity and relationships.
Part 3: The Solo Journey
In this section, Ricky Martin delves into his solo career and the pivotal moments that shaped his path to international stardom. He discusses his breakthrough with the hit song "Livin' La Vida Loca" and the challenges he faced as a gay artist in the music industry. Martin also opens up about his exploration of his sexuality and his journey towards self-acceptance.
Part 4: Beyond the Spotlight
The final part of the memoir explores Ricky Martin's experiences as a father, his humanitarian work, and his spiritual journey. He shares the joy and challenges of parenthood, his advocacy for causes close to his heart, and his exploration of different spiritual practices. Martin concludes the memoir with a reflection on his personal growth and the lessons he has learned along the way.
